Sticky, frizzy temperamental curls!
Hello curly girls!
I've been reading this site for over 3 months now, soaking in (and trying to put into practice) all of the great techniques, advice, information and science out there. Now I am finally going to reach out and seek the help I so desperately need from you wonderfully knowledgeable curlies!
I started the CG method about 2 months ago. Before I started, I had been seriously damaging my hair for about 4 years with blow dryers and flat irons. Needless to say my hair is extremely damaged. Therefore I know that I need to be patient, and treat the CG method as a process, but my hair still seems to be reacting badly 2+ months in (and reacting more badly than others that are in the same position as me - my mom started it at the same time, with very similar hair, and hers looks fab).
From what I can tell my hair is 2c/3a, depending on the section of hair. It is fine, medium density, and high porosity. I have been low'pooing (once every week or two) with devacurl low poo. CO with suave naturals coconut, and RO with Aubry GPB. I use a micro fibre towel to scrunch my hair and use Devacurl light defining gel as a styling product (and occasionally also suave as a LI). Even though my hair feels lovely and soft when wet, after it dries it feels relatively sticky and dry (mostly at the top). It also dries far more curly at the roots through to about 4 inches down, and then after that it is almost wavy. Put all of this together and people have referred to my hair as looking like dreadlocks (that is not the look i'm going for!). I've questioned whether this is protein insensitivity, however from what I can tell it is not since that would mean my hair would be more extremely dry and tangled (whereas mine is relatively dry-frizzy but sticky and soft at the tips).
I should also add that I live in Toronto, where the dew point is very high in summer (right now)!
